Overview of the Freestyle Libre System and Its Data

The Freestyle Libre system is a continuous glucose monitoring (CGM) system that uses a small sensor worn on the back of the upper arm. This sensor automatically measures glucose levels in the interstitial fluid every minute. The data is then transmitted to a compatible reader or smartphone, where users can view their current glucose reading, historical trends, and additional insights.

The system is designed to provide comprehensive data, including the glucose value, trend arrows, and a graph showing glucose fluctuations over time. This data is critical for making informed decisions about diet, exercise, and medication. The data itself consists of the following elements:

  • Current Glucose Reading: The most recent glucose value, typically displayed in mg/dL or mmol/L.
  • Trend Arrows: Indicators showing the direction and rate of change of glucose levels (e.g., rising, falling, stable).
  • Historical Data: A graph or list of previous glucose readings, allowing users to track patterns and identify trends.
  • Average Glucose: An overview of the average glucose levels over a specified period.
  • Time in Range: The percentage of time glucose levels are within a target range.

Factors Affecting Glucose Reading Accuracy

Several factors can influence the accuracy of the glucose readings displayed by the Freestyle Libre widget. It’s essential to be aware of these to interpret the data effectively and make informed decisions about your health.

  • Sensor Placement and Application: Proper sensor placement, as per the manufacturer’s instructions, is paramount. Incorrect application can lead to inaccurate readings. The sensor should be inserted into the subcutaneous tissue, avoiding areas with excessive scar tissue, tattoos, or where clothing might rub. Imagine a scenario: if the sensor isn’t properly attached, the readings might be off by a significant margin.
  • Calibration and Initial Warm-Up: The sensor needs a warm-up period after initial application. During this time, the readings may be less accurate. Also, while the Freestyle Libre system does not require fingerstick calibration, the initial accuracy can be impacted. Consider this: during the first hour after sensor insertion, compare readings with a finger-prick blood glucose meter to establish a baseline.
  • Compression and Pressure: Pressure on the sensor, such as sleeping on it or wearing tight clothing, can affect readings. This can cause the glucose values to be artificially high or low. Think of it like this: if you’re consistently getting low readings, check if your sensor is being compressed.
  • Environmental Conditions: Extreme temperatures can impact sensor performance. Avoid exposing the sensor to very high or very low temperatures. For instance, leaving the sensor in a hot car during summer could compromise its functionality.
  • Medications and Supplements: Certain medications, such as high doses of Vitamin C (ascorbic acid), can interfere with glucose readings. Always inform your healthcare provider about any medications or supplements you are taking. Consider the potential for interference, and discuss any concerns with your healthcare team.
  • Dehydration: Severe dehydration can affect glucose readings. Staying adequately hydrated is essential for accurate readings. Picture a dry sponge: it doesn’t absorb water properly. Similarly, the sensor may not function accurately if the body is dehydrated.
  • Sensor Age and Performance: Sensor performance can degrade over time. Be mindful of the sensor’s lifespan and replace it as recommended by the manufacturer. As an example, a sensor nearing its expiration date might show less accurate results compared to a new one.

Verifying Widget Data

Verifying the data displayed by the widget is a critical step in ensuring its accuracy. Here’s how you can do it effectively.

  • Regular Fingerstick Blood Glucose Checks: Periodically compare the widget’s readings with a fingerstick blood glucose meter, especially during periods of suspected inaccurate readings or when experiencing symptoms that don’t align with the widget data. This cross-validation provides a benchmark. For example, if you feel hypoglycemic, but the widget shows a normal reading, a fingerstick can confirm the true glucose level.
  • Check for Trends and Consistency: Observe the trends in your glucose readings over time. Look for patterns and consistency. If you notice unexpected spikes or drops, investigate the cause. If the widget consistently shows high readings in the morning, explore possible reasons, such as the dawn phenomenon.
  • Consider the Lag Time: The Freestyle Libre system measures glucose in the interstitial fluid, which may lag behind the blood glucose levels. Be aware of this lag, especially after meals or rapid changes in blood glucose. Remember, after eating, the blood glucose rises faster than the interstitial glucose.
  • Review the Data with Your Healthcare Provider: Share your widget data with your healthcare provider during your appointments. They can help you interpret the data and identify any potential issues. They can also offer personalized advice.

Exporting Data for Health Reports

Exporting your data is a vital step in creating health reports, allowing you to share comprehensive information with your healthcare team or analyze trends yourself. The process is generally straightforward and offers several export options.

  • Data Export Methods: The method for exporting your data will depend on the specific Freestyle Libre system you are using. Generally, you can export your data through the LibreView or LibreLink apps, or directly from the reader device. Look for options like “Export Data,” “Download Data,” or “Share Data.”
  • File Formats: Data can usually be exported in several formats, including CSV (Comma Separated Values) and PDF. CSV files are ideal for importing data into spreadsheets for detailed analysis, while PDF reports are useful for sharing with your healthcare provider.
  • Exporting Steps (Example): The exact steps for exporting data will vary based on your device and the apps you are using. However, a common workflow involves:
    • Opening the LibreView or LibreLink app.
    • Navigating to the “Data” or “Reports” section.
    • Selecting the date range for the data you wish to export.
    • Choosing your preferred export format (CSV or PDF).
    • Following the on-screen prompts to save or share the file.
  • Data Analysis: Once you have exported your data, you can analyze it to identify patterns and trends in your glucose levels. Use spreadsheet software like Microsoft Excel or Google Sheets to create charts and graphs. Consider consulting with a healthcare professional to get help with data interpretation.
